Jussie Smollett will not be back on 'Empire when the six-part series comes to a close in May.
The 37-year-old actor was accused of having orchestrated a racist attack on himself back in January, and although he had the case against him dropped in March, he filed a petition for malicious prosecution, claiming officials created the narrative and it has cost him hugely.
As a result, Fox's Entertainment President, Michael Thorn, confirmed there were "no plans" for him to return to the show, with his last appearance in June.
"We're not going to bring Jussie back to the show," he told TVLine, adding that there were "many factors" to the "hard decision", but ultimately they didn't want the "controversy surrounding Jussie to overshadow the show".
